Former Manchester United captain Roy Keane says he rates Liverpool centre-back Virgil van Dijk very highly. Comparing him to his former Dutch teammate Jaap Stam, the Irishman said the Reds defender is better in possession than the treble winner:

“I’m a big fan on Van Dijk. The guy’s a machine. He’s probably a little better on the ball than Stam.”

The ex-United star generally doesn’t give out much praise for players, particularly if they play for Liverpool, but even he can’t hide his admiration for van Dijk.

The 28-year-old has been a key player since he moved to Anfield from Southampton two years ago. In the past two seasons, he has only been on the losing side once in the Premier League, which tells you all you need to know about the Netherlands international.

Of course, van Dijk isn’t the only reason for the Reds’ superb defensive record, with the likes of Alisson and Joe Gomez also playing a crucial role.

However, without the Dutch star, it is fair to say that Jurgen Klopp’s side would have achieved a lot less success over the past few years.
